Our approach to managing mineral waste and ARD - Rio Tinto
Mineral waste management: Mineral wastes include waste rock, tailings and slag: • Waste rock is composed of rock that has uneconomic mineral content and must be removed to access ore during mining. • Tailings are finely ground rock mixed with process water. This is what remains after the minerals of economic interest have been removed from ...

[PDF] CHAPTER 11: MINE WASTE DUMP - Semantic Scholar
The Overburden of waste and uneconomic mineralized rock is required to be removed to mine the useful mineral resource in a surface mining operation. In this process a dump is formed by casting the waste material and dumping it in nearby area. The dump so formed is known as mine waste dump. Waste dump may be classified as internal and external dump.
